WebDec 9, 2024 · Merychippus. M erychippus represents a milestone in the evolution of horses. Though it retained the primitive character of 3 toes, it looked like a modern horse. Merychippus had a long face. Its long legs allowed it to escape from predators and migrate long distances to feed. It had high-crowned cheek teeth, making it the first known grazing ... WebSeahorses have a long, horse-like head (hence their name) and a curled tail. Seahorses range in size from under a centimetre long (Pygmy Seahorses) to about 12 inches (30.5 centimetres) long. Seahorses have armoured plates that cover their body (they do not have scales like other fish). The sections of a seahorse are the head, trunk and tail.
